   Sec. 14. Every employer paying compensation directly without insurance and every insurance carrier paying compensation in behalf of an employer shall, within ten (10) days from the termination of the compensation period fixed in any award against him or its insured, for an injury or death, either by the approval of an agreement or upon hearing, and within ten (10) days from the full redemption of any such award by the cash payment thereof in a lump sum as provided in IC 22-3-2 through IC 22-3-6, make such report or reports as the worker’s compensation board may require.

Formerly: Acts 1929, c.172, s.67. As amended by P.L.144-1986, SEC.49; P.L.28-1988, SEC.41.
